摘要

目的: 分析包头市养殖人员中戊型肝炎病毒(HEV)感染的流行病学特点,评估不同年龄组养殖人群的感染率,为该养殖人群预防和控制戊型肝炎提供数据支持。方法: 2023年7月至2024年7月期间收集包头市养殖(猪、牛、羊)人员的血样标本,通过ELISA法检测血清中HEV-IgG抗体。研究样本根据年龄分组,并统计各年龄组的感染阳性率。结果: 共收集样本679例,各年龄组感染阳性率分别为:0岁至≤20岁组3.23%,>20岁且≤30岁组10.87%,>30岁且≤40岁组14.93%,>40岁且≤50岁组41.28%,>50岁且≤60岁组50.00%,>60岁且≤70岁组34.52%,>70岁且≤80岁组68.57%,>80岁且≤90岁组60.00%。卡方检验结果显示,>30岁且≤40岁、>40岁且≤50岁、>50岁且≤60岁、>70岁且≤80岁和>80岁且≤90岁的感染阳性率与其他年龄组相比具有显著性差异(P<0.001)。结论: 包头市养殖人群中HEV感染阳性率较高,尤其在40岁以上的群体中更为显著,提示该地区养殖人群可能面临较高的HEV暴露风险,需加强该病毒的防控。

Abstract

Objective: To analyze the epidemiological characteristics of hepatitis E virus (HEV) infection among aquaculture population in Baotou City, and to evaluate the infection rate of different age groups, so as to provide data support for the prevention and control of hepatitis E in the aquaculture population. Methods: Blood samples of aquaculture population (pigs, cattle, sheep) in Baotou City from July 2023 to July 2024 were collected, and HEV-IgG antibodies in serum were detected by ELISA. Grouped according to the age, and the positive rate of infection in each age group was counted. Results: A total of 679 samples were collected. The positive infection rates of each age group were as follows: the group from 0 to≤20 years was 3.23%,>20 to≤30 years was 10.87%,>30 to≤40 years was 14.93%, >40 to≤50 years was 41.28%, >50 to≤60 years was 50.00%,>60 to≤70 years was 34.52%, >70 to≤80 years was 68.57%, >80 to≤90 years was 60.00%. The results of the chi-square test showed that the positive infection rates of the groups >30 to≤40 years old,>40 to≤50 years old, >50 to≤60 years,>70 to≤80 years, and>80 years to≤90 years were significantly different compared with those of other age groups (P<0.001). Conclusion: The positive rate of HEV infection in Baotou breeding population is higher, especially in the population over 40 years old, indicating that the aquaculture population may face a higher risk of HEV exposure, and it is necessary to strengthen the prevention and control of this virus.
